Stephen Spinella (born October 11, 1956)[1] is an American stage, television, and film actor.

Early life and career

Spinella was born in Naples, Italy, to a father who was an American naval airplane mechanic.[1] He grew up in Glendale, Arizona,[1] and graduated from the University of Arizona with a degree in drama. He also attended NYU's Tisch School of the Arts' Graduate Acting Program, graduating in 1982.[2]

Spinella won consecutive Tony Awards for Best Featured Actor in a Play and Best Actor in a Play for his performance as Prior Walter in Angels in America: Millennium Approaches and Angels in America: Perestroika in 1993 and 1994, respectively. He was also nominated for Best Featured Actor in a Musical in 2000 for James Joyce's The Dead.
